Transaction 673b77befdd19459572feec2ca380656fbe3776853c1825161b6667256a4a5a6
1 Input
1 Output
-
673b77befdd19459572feec2ca380656fbe3776853c1825161b6667256a4a5a6:0
- value
- 25080
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e617d88e116d645301434dde1236b8fb1cb75cf7aaf4d77d11cde4377b05ac52
- address
- bc1pucta3rs3d4j9xq2rfh0pyd4clvwtwh8h4t6dwlg3ehjrw7c943fqn4krwr